Councillor Dan Hassett says Starbucks are definitely coming to Folkestone now:
There has been much speculation about Starbucks opening in Folkestone. I can finally confirm that they will be opening in the new Bouverie Place shopping centre. They have applied for permission to extend opening hours to 7am-10pm and to have an outdoor seating area.
A bank/building society/Bureau de Change will also be opening in Bouverie Place. There have been rumours that HSBC is moving in. It's a large unit spread over two floors.
